What does "bandit" mean?

  1. noun An armed robber, especially one operating with a gang in a remote or lawless area.
    "The stagecoach was ambushed by bandits in the mountain pass."
  2. noun In military aviation, an aircraft confirmed to be hostile or enemy-operated.
    "Radar picked up a bandit closing fast from the north."
